Why energy efficiency matters for live events and venues

Operational cost is the largest recurring line item

As someone who has audited venue infrastructure, I can tell you that energy and maintenance together typically form the biggest ongoing cost associated with stage lighting. Switching to LED stage flood lights reduces wattage and extends lamp life, which lowers electricity bills and service interruptions. The U.S. Department of Energy documents that LEDs can use 50%–75% less energy than conventional lighting while delivering comparable or better light output (DOE: LED lighting).

Heat, HVAC load and equipment longevity

LEDs generate substantially less radiant heat than metal halide or tungsten floods. Lower heat output reduces HVAC load during events and decreases stress on truss, cabling and dimming electronics. This indirectly lengthens the life of other equipment and reduces cooling energy—another less-visible but verifiable saving.

Key specifications to evaluate LED stage flood lights

Lumen output and efficacy (lm/W)

When comparing a legacy flood to an LED, match delivered lumens (not just wattage). Efficacy (lm/W) shows how efficiently a lamp converts electricity to light. Modern professional LED flood fixtures commonly achieve 100–180 lm/W depending on optics and driver design. For baseline technical context about LEDs, see the technology overview on Wikipedia (LED - Wikipedia).

Color quality: CCT and CRI/CRI 2017

Color temperature (CCT) affects mood; stage floods are often offered 2700K–6500K or variable CCT. Color rendering (CRI or more modern metrics like TM-30) matters when performers’ skin tones and costume color fidelity are important. I generally specify CRI > 90 or TM-30 values suitable for broadcast/stage work when color accuracy is critical.

Optics, beam spread and flicker

Choose optics that produce the needed beam spread (wide wash vs narrow flood). Also confirm driver design for flicker-free operation at high frame rates for TV and camera capture. Modern LED drivers and well-designed fixtures address PWM flicker; always test with your camera system prior to full deployment.

Sensitivity and local variables

Key variables that change ROI: local energy price, annual operating hours, labor costs for lamp replacement, and incentives/rebates. Many utilities and governments offer incentives for LED upgrades—check local programs to shorten payback.

Practical selection checklist and installation considerations

IP rating and environment (indoor/outdoor touring)

For outdoor concerts or venues with unpredictable weather, choose IP65 or higher waterproof/dustproof-rated fixtures. For indoor theaters, IP20 may suffice. Waterproof LED stage flood lights with reliable sealing and conformal-coated PCBs reduce field failures in humid or dusty environments.

Control compatibility and dimming

Confirm DMX512, RDM, Art-Net or wireless DMX compatibility as required. Flicker-free dimming and smooth low-end behavior are essential for theatrical fades and broadcast capture. Ask vendors for test footage or request on-site demos to validate performance with your lighting console and cameras.

Build quality and warranty

Evaluate the driver supplier, thermal management design (heatsink, fanless vs active cooling), and warranty terms. Reputable manufacturers will provide detailed photometric files (IES files), TM-30/CRI data, and reliability testing. Practical deployment tips from field experience

Test with photometrics and in-situ trials

Ask your supplier for IES files and run them in your plotting software to check beam angles and lux levels before purchase. A short rental or demo run helps validate color rendering and dimming behavior in camera conditions.

Plan spare parts and preventive maintenance

Stock critical spares (drivers, control boards, connectors) and establish a preventive maintenance cadence. LEDs reduce lamp changes but you should still plan for cleaning optics, checking seals on waterproof fixtures and verifying thermal paths annually.

Document total cost and environmental impact

When presenting to stakeholders, include energy cost projections, CO2 reduction estimates and the expected service life. Reliable sources such as the DOE can help verify baseline energy savings assumptions (DOE: LED lighting).

FAQ — Common questions about LED stage flood lights

Q: How much energy can I realistically save by switching to LED stage floods?

A: Typical savings are 50%–75% on fixture energy compared with metal halide or incandescent floods, depending on lumen matching and control. Exact savings depend on your wattage before and after conversion and operating hours. The DOE provides practical LED energy-efficiency guidance (DOE).

Q: Will LEDs give me the same brightness and look as my old floods?

A: LEDs can match or exceed perceived brightness when you compare delivered lumens and beam optics. You should match photometric output (lumens and beam distribution) rather than wattage. Testing with IES files and on-site demos is best.

Q: How long do professional LED floods last before replacement?

A: Many professional fixtures are rated for 50,000 hours or more for 70% lumen maintenance (L70). Real-world lifetime depends on thermal management and operating environment.

Q: Do LED floods cause flicker on camera?

A: Proper drivers and well-designed fixtures are flicker-free at broadcast frame rates. Always test fixtures with your specific camera systems—ask suppliers for flicker test reports or sample footage.

Q: What IP rating do I need for outdoor concerts?

A: For outdoor use, IP65 is a common minimum for fixtures exposed to rain and dust. For fixtures subjected to direct water spray or harsh conditions, consider IP66 or higher.

Q: Are there rebates or incentives for upgrading to LED stage lighting?

A: Often yes—many utilities and governments provide industrial or commercial lighting incentives for energy-saving upgrades. Check with local utility programs to see available rebates which can materially shorten payback periods.
